Triplex

A single building with three separate units. Same idea as a duplex, one more unit. Still qualifies for residential financing.

Why a seller cares

Three units still finance as residential, and a buyer can live in one with an FHA loan. Like every small multi-family, it sells on rents, leases and expenses more than finishes.

A simple example

Your triplex rents for $1,000, $1,050 and $1,100 a month. An FHA buyer plans to live in the smallest unit and asks for all three leases.

Triplex: a simple example
What the buyer wantsWhat you provide
The leases and rent rollCopies, with lease end dates
ExpensesTaxes, insurance, utilities you pay, repairs
Which unit is vacant or can beA date, if they plan to live there

A triplex is a house-sized building with a business inside it.

What people get wrong

That an owner-occupant buyer cannot buy a triplex. FHA and conventional loans both allow up to four units when the buyer lives in one.
